Many of Australia's leading brokers have been working hard on their financial models and adjusting their recommendations accordingly ahead of earnings season.

Three shares that have come out of this favourably are listed below. Here's why they have been given buy ratings:

Origin Energy Ltd (ASX: ORG)

According to a note out of Morgans, its analysts have retained their add rating and lifted the price target on this energy company's shares to $8.15. The broker believes the sharp decline in its share price over the last 12 months due to regulatory concerns and falling oil prices has created a buying opportunity for investors. Especially given how the company has worked hard to mitigate the risks. In addition to this, Morgans believes that Origin could be well placed to increase its dividends in the future after de-leveraging. Reliance Worldwide Corporation Ltd (ASX: RWC)

A note out of the Macquarie equities desk reveals that its analysts have retained their outperform rating and $6.40 price target on this plumbing parts company after it reaffirmed its guidance for FY 2019, albeit with a skew to the second half. According to the note, the broker was not expecting Reliance Worldwide to have such a large skew, but it remains confident on its outlook. Reliance Worldwide remains its favourite pick in the sector. Telstra Corporation Ltd (ASX: TLS)

Analysts at Goldman Sachs have retained their conviction buy rating and $3.60 price target on this telco giant's shares after TPG Telecom Ltd (ASX: TPM) announced that it would end it mobile network rollout. According to the note, Goldman believes Telstra is set to lead the market with its 5G offering, which is a big positive as it sees clear upside for the market's 5G leader. In addition to this, it believes its long term earnings are positive due to its dominant mobile network and the significant opportunity to reduce costs through the digitalisation and simplification of its business.
